Output 50c990503a4771e138e888c065dc36a0915e7dd13d9b45abc4bb0eab2b6e4b4e:44

value
8388608
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e619fa3297444bb4940fec1af58aef7039f10f6c8cc3ecef6cea81f71859dda9
address
bc1pucvl5v5hg39mf9q0asd0tzh0wqulzrmv3np7emmva2qlwxzemk5sryfuea
transaction
50c990503a4771e138e888c065dc36a0915e7dd13d9b45abc4bb0eab2b6e4b4e
spent
true